5,000 beta test spots available for Ubisoft's newest MMORPG.
Ubisoft today announced the beginning of a beta testing stage for Far Cry, a PC MMORPG. Commencing on Monday, December 8th at 20:00 GMT, 5,000 gamers worldwide will have the exclusive opportunity to take part in the beta test.
Not much is known about Farcry, though the following features have been confirmed:
-A "sniper flare" that allows other players in the game to pinpoint the position of other snipers by light reflecting from the sniper scope.
-The support class which can build or even repair destructible structures such as bunkers, towers, roadblocks, mounted weapons and walls.
The beta test registration will run for several days from Monday, December 8th 2003. These individuals will be the first people outside of Ubisoft to experience this highly anticipated FPS, and they will also work with the team in order to help balance the game.
The initial beta signup will take place on December 8th 2003. Registration will be via links on the http://www.farcry-thegame.com.
Once registration is closed, Ubisoft will select 5,000 testers that will best reflect the widest variety of geographical locations.
